中文摘要:
      目的 分析2004-2018年中国<1岁组儿童低出生体重儿死亡水平与变化趋势。方法 利用公开出版的《2004-2018年中国死因监测数据集》,分析我国<1岁组儿童在不同性别、城乡、地区的低出生体重儿死亡率、构成比及变化趋势。分析城乡、东/中/西部地区不同性别<1岁组低出生体重儿死亡率、构成比及变化趋势。采用加权最小二乘法拟合Joinpoint回归模型分析时间变化趋势,计算各时间段内年度变化百分比(APC)、全时段内平均年度变化百分比(AAPC)及其95% CI结果 2004-2018年<1岁组低出生体重儿死亡率呈下降趋势,年平均下降幅度为-8.0%(95% CI:-10.6%~-5.4%),不同性别、城乡、地区间的差异逐渐缩小。2004-2018年<1岁组低出生体重儿死亡构成比呈上升趋势,年平均上升幅度为1.6%(95% CI:0.1%~3.2%)。<1岁组低出生体重儿死亡率城市(38.74/10万)高于农村(30.44/10万),城市<1岁组低出生体重儿死亡率年平均下降速度(-3.4%,95% CI:-7.0%~0.3%)低于农村(-9.3%,95% CI:-12.0%~-6.6%);<1岁组男童低出生体重儿死亡率(36.25/10万)高于女童(28.22/10万);西部地区<1岁组儿童低出生体重死亡构成比呈上升趋势,平均每年变化为3.2%(95% CI:1.7%~4.8%),变化速度高于东部地区的-0.5%(95% CI:-2.3%~1.4%);不同城乡、地区间<1岁组低出生体重儿死亡率男童均高于女童。结论 2004-2018年<1岁组低出生体重儿死亡率呈下降趋势,构成比均呈上升趋势,建议以男童和中、西部地区儿童作为今后妇幼保健工作的重点人群。
英文摘要:
      Objective To analyze the level and trend of low birth weight mortality in children under 1 year old in China from 2004 to 2018. Methods The published Data Set of National Mortality Surveillance from 2004 to 2018 was used to analyze the low birth weight mortality rate, constituent ratio and changing trend in boys and girls, in urban area and rural area and in different regions in China. The Joinpoint regression model fitted by the weighted least square method was used to analyze the time variation trend and calculate the annual percentage change (APC), the average annual percentage change (AAPC) and their 95% confidence intervals in each time period. Results From 2004 to 2018, the low birth weight mortality rate in children under 1 year old in China showed a decreasing trend with an AAPC of -8.0% (95% CI: -10.6% - -5.4%). The differences between boys and girls, between urban area and rural area and among different regions gradually reduced. From 2004 to 2018, the constituent ratio of low birth weight mortality showed an increasing trend with an AAPC of 1.6% (95% CI: 0.1%-3.2%). The mortality rate in urban area (38.74 per 100 000) was higher than that in rural area (30.44 per 100 000). The annual average declining speed of low birth weight mortality rate in urban area (AAPC= -3.4%, 95% CI: -7.0%-0.3%) was slower than that in rural area (AAPC= -9.3%, 95% CI: -12.0% - -6.6%). The low birth weight mortality rate of boys (36.25 per 100 000) was higher than that of girls (28.22 per 100 000). The low birth weight mortality constituent ratio in western region showed an increasing trend, its average annual percentage change (AAPC=3.2%, 95% CI: 1.7%-4.8%) increased faster than that of the eastern region (AAPC=-0.5%, 95% CI: -2.3%-1.4%). In urban and rural areas and different regions, the rate of low birth weight mortality in boys was higher than that in girls. Conclusions From 2004 to 2018, the mortality rate of low birth weight in children under 1 year old showed a downward trend, and the constituent ratio showed an upward trend. Boys and children living in central and western regions should be the key population for maternal and child health care.
